Skip to product information
1 of 1

Natrol

Natrol Vitamin D3 Maximum Strength Bone & Joint Tablets 10,000 IU 60 count

Natrol Vitamin D3 Maximum Strength Bone & Joint Tablets 10,000 IU 60 count

Regular price $20.40 USD
Regular price Sale price $20.40 USD
Sale Sold out
View full details